Organization Receives Grant To Teach Motorcycle Safety
The Kevin P. Mahurin Motorcycle Awareness Foundation will use a grant from the Govenor's Office of Highway Safety to teach safety to children.
The Governor's Office Of Highway Safety (GOHS) in Georgia has awarded a Canton-based organization money to teach children about motorcycle safety. GOHS awarded a $25,000 grant to the Kevin P. Mahurin Motorcycle Awareness Foundation, which would be used to develop books that teach motorcycle safety to children ages 8 to 12. "We have worked very hard over the last four years to grow the foundation and take our message to auto and motorcycle drivers," said Cherokee County District 3 Commissioner Karen Bosch, the founder and chair of the foundation.
